In today's digital age, the concept of memory has evolved significantly. One of the most common forms of memory used in computers is known as disk memory. This term refers to the storage capacity found on hard drives and solid-state drives, which are essential components of any computing device. Understanding disk memory is crucial for anyone who uses a computer, as it directly impacts performance and storage capabilities.Disk memory plays a vital role in how data is stored and retrieved. Unlike RAM (Random Access Memory), which is volatile and loses its content when the power is turned off, disk memory retains information even when the computer is shut down. This makes it an ideal choice for long-term data storage. When you save a file, install software, or download media, it is typically stored on disk memory.The two main types of disk memory are Hard Disk Drives (HDD) and Solid State Drives (SSD). HDDs use spinning disks coated with magnetic material to read and write data, while SSDs use flash memory to store data electronically. The differences between these two types of disk memory are significant. HDDs tend to offer larger storage capacities at a lower cost, but they are slower and more prone to mechanical failure. On the other hand, SSDs provide faster data access speeds, improved durability, and lower power consumption, making them increasingly popular among users.When considering the amount of disk memory needed for a computer, various factors come into play. For instance, a user who primarily uses their computer for browsing the internet and writing documents may require less disk memory than someone who edits videos or plays high-end video games. Therefore, it's essential to assess your usage patterns when determining the appropriate amount of disk memory for your needs.Another important aspect of disk memory is its organization. Data is stored in files and directories, which help users manage and locate their information easily. Understanding how to navigate through disk memory can enhance productivity and ensure that important files are not lost. Regularly organizing and backing up data stored on disk memory is also crucial to prevent data loss and to maintain optimal performance.Moreover, the speed of disk memory can significantly affect overall system performance.
